Compare Murrieta to Mission Viejo

This post compares Murrieta, California to Mission Viejo,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Murrieta (city) Mission Viejo (city)
Population 110,043 96,535
Income (median) $58,676 $73,215
Home Value (median) $367,400 $640,800
White 64% 78%
Black 6% 1%
Asian 9% 10%
With Kids 46% 31%
Age (median) 33 44
Rentals 33% 22%
